Output 596eb91b8ae67bab09dcafe086909d12d7d451cca0b6986bb12d34b85d75b82e:0

value
183135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9403e418a90a1c87d6c399942259655109b1393 OP_EQUAL
address
3NxLKwCAFgQfHpBDZJpZ3gBQCM6dXpcTv6
transaction
596eb91b8ae67bab09dcafe086909d12d7d451cca0b6986bb12d34b85d75b82e
confirmations
271880
spent
true